This summer we went to the Beijing Wildlife Park. It is like a zoo except at the end you get a ride in the back of a truck that has chain link all around and you go into the wild animal cages with meat hung on the outside of the truck. We had grizzly bears and tigers come up and eat just a few inches from where we sat. Our pictures are not the greatest because we were too busy checking out the animals but you get the main idea. This was way cool but it is definitely a Chinese thing. Their safety guidelines are not what ours are in the States. Things are always a little risky here but that is what makes it so fun. We were told that a few months after we were there a little boy got into the lion area and was pretty close to one of the lions before the parents realized. The father panicked (who wouldn't) and ran in front of the lion. This spooked the lion and the father was attacked and killed. Crazy! Anyway, this was neat.
